- The distance between Fanø, Nordby (Esbjerg), Denmark and London-Gatwick, Uk is approximately 739 km or 459 mi.
- To reach Fanø, Nordby (Esbjerg) in this distance one would set out from London-Gatwick bearing 47.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Fanø, Nordby (Esbjerg) bearing 54° or NE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The annual average temperature is 0.9 °C (1.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4 °C (7.2°F) more in Fanø, Nordby (Esbjerg). The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 25 mm (1 in) less which is equivalent to 25 l/m² (0.61 US gal/ft²) or 250,000 l/ha (26,727 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.2° lower in Fanø, Nordby (Esbjerg) than in London-Gatwick.
